Output 3bef852098c32fb24632df2427d2a3c1b014a593aa968b337d25ee58cfa1eafa:0

value
649278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703a9cb023f54ae0ccda0ed4e9103cd8a4cd10a0 OP_EQUAL
address
3BvRpTznkeWfhxrCY9xuKQiD99JWAfC28m
transaction
3bef852098c32fb24632df2427d2a3c1b014a593aa968b337d25ee58cfa1eafa
spent
true